Patient care

As a Registered Nurse, you will be an integral member of the interprofessional team at the Uxbridge site. You will practice in an environment where the emphasis is on activation, professional practice and customer satisfaction. The incumbent will be required to cover the Emergency Department and Endoscopy as required.  Created with Sketch.

Support

Using your clinical expertise, you will, in collaboration with the team, be responsible for comprehensive assessment, care planning, patient education and discharge planning to support the continuity of care throughout the patient’s stay on the inpatient unit.

Qualifications

Current Certificate of Registration with the College of Nurses. Current BCLS. Recent experience in medicine/telemetry with an emphasis on rehabilitation and geriatrics. Completion of the Coronary Care 1 program or equivalent is essential (or a willingness to complete within 6 months of employment). RNAO membership is preferred. Excellent physical assessment skills. Proficient computer skills.  Created with Sketch.
